Spike TV today announced the nominees of "VGA TEN" – the network's tenth annual live televised event to celebrate the best in video games. VGA TEN, hosted by Samuel L. Jackson, will feature exclusive world premieres as well as musical performances by Linkin Park and Tenacious D. The interactive multiplatform special will premiere LIVE from Sony Picture Studios in Culver City, CA on Friday, December 7 at 9:00 PM ET/6:00 PM PT on Spike TV. Additionally, VGA TEN will simulcast on MTV 2, MTV Tr3s, Xbox LIVE, Spike.com and GameTrailers.com.

Post by: shadowDOESrock on November 27, 2012, 02:26:11 PM
Quote from: windlessusher on November 27, 2012, 02:10:40 PM
Nintendo not showing support for good game? lolwut?

Namely Xenoblade Chronicles, The Last Story and Pandoras Tower.
The Last Story wasnt even brought over by Nintendo themselves, but by XSEED.
Nintendo of Europe brought Pandoras Tower to Europe & Australia, but not America.
And Xenoblade Chronicles was brought over by Nintendo of Europe in August of 2011 and after it did well it came to 'merica on April 6, 2012.

All three games where originally Nintendo Published Games and all came out a year before their EU Release Date in Japan.


Nintendo of America thinks Japanesey JRPG's will perform bad in western lands. Especially America.

Aaaaaaaaand... none of the Games sold well in the end in the west.
So good luck getting Nintendo's Wii U JRPG's over.
